Total Care are recruiting for a dedicated Charge Nurse to come join an excellent nursing home in the Bangor area. This position is within a fantastic facility offering a great salary and benefit package.

What's on offer as Charge nurse:
  • Full time, Permanent
  • £46,000
  • Training and Development opportunities to help you grow in your career
  • Excellent Holidays
  • Pension
  • Free equipment
  • And more!
What you will do as a Charge Nurse:
  • Producing well-developed care plans and detailed risk assessments, with an understanding of regulatory frameworks
  • Maintain accurate documentation and resident records whilst incorporating the use of modern technology
  • Overseeing all aspects of medicine management on your shift in accordance with company policies and current legislation
  • Responsible for making decisions in a timely manner
  • Utilising your clinical skills to provide guidance and support to all team members
What you need:
  • 1 year's experience in a similar role or within a nursing role
  • Registered RGN, RMN or RLDN qualification
  • Active NMC pin
  • Eligibility to live and work in the UK
